How to choose a suitable location for solar PV power plants?

The installation of solar PV power plants requires vast land and huge investment. Therefore, it is necessary to select a suitable site to achieve maximum efficiency and low cost. A feasible location of photovoltaic (PV) system must consider certain criteria including land restrictions, access to roads, and transmission lines.

How many centralized PV stations are there in 2023?

In 2023, we identified 688 centralized PV stations, covering a total area of 719.28 km². Using the Continuous Change Detection and Classification (CCDC) algorithm along with Global Moran’s I, we observed significant development in PV installations between 2013 and 2021, with smaller stations being more spatially dispersed.

What factors determine a feasible location of a photovoltaic system?

A feasible location of photovoltaic (PV) system must consider certain criteria including land restrictions, access to roads, and transmission lines. This study analyzed ten factors grouped into four categories: geographic, technical, economic, and flood susceptibility criterion.

How close should a solar PV power plant be to a city?

It is evaluated that a PV power plant should be within 15 km of proximity to these big cities. The reclassification values are given in Table 2. The flood risk needs to be considered while selecting a site for the solar PV power plant to prevent the loss of massive investment.
